OpenClaw(龙虾)在宝塔怎么恢复视频教程
2026-03-19 2引言
OpenClaw(龙虾)是一个面向跨境电商卖家的开源自动化运维与数据采集工具,常用于店铺监控、价格爬取、竞品分析等场景;宝塔指宝塔面板(BT Panel),是国产Linux服务器可视化管理软件。本指南聚焦于:当OpenClaw因系统重装、配置丢失或误删导致失效后,如何在宝塔环境中完整恢复其运行环境及视频教程所涉功能。

要点速读(TL;DR)
- OpenClaw非宝塔原生插件,需手动部署Python环境+依赖库+定时任务
- 恢复核心 = 重装Python项目 + 还原config.yaml + 重启Supervisor进程
- 视频教程通常含宝塔终端操作、计划任务配置、日志排查三步,缺一不可
- 常见失败点:Python版本不匹配、pip源被墙、Supervisor未启用、宝塔防火墙拦截端口
它能解决哪些问题
- 场景痛点1:服务器重装/迁移后OpenClaw脚本无法运行 → 价值:通过标准化恢复流程,5分钟内重建采集服务
- 场景痛点2:视频教程中演示的“自动截图+上传”功能失效 → 价值:定位宝塔计划任务与OpenClaw cron配置冲突,修复执行权限
- 场景痛点3:日志显示“ModuleNotFoundError: No module named 'requests'” → 价值:明确宝塔Python管理器中虚拟环境与全局pip的调用关系,避免依赖错装
怎么用/怎么开通/怎么选择
OpenClaw无官方“开通”流程,属自托管工具,恢复需人工操作。以下是基于宝塔面板(v8.0+)的通用恢复步骤:
- 确认基础环境:登录宝塔 → 【软件商店】→ 安装【Python项目管理器】(推荐Python 3.9+)
- 还原代码文件:将备份的OpenClaw项目文件夹(含main.py、config.yaml、requirements.txt)上传至/www/wwwroot/openclaw/
- 配置Python环境:进入【Python项目管理器】→ 新建项目 → 选择路径/www/wwwroot/openclaw/ → 指定Python版本 → 勾选【安装依赖】并指定requirements.txt
- 设置守护进程:使用宝塔【Supervisor管理器】添加进程:命令为
/www/server/python/bin/python3 /www/wwwroot/openclaw/main.py,工作目录填项目路径 - 配置定时任务(如需):【计划任务】→ 添加Shell脚本 → 内容为
cd /www/wwwroot/openclaw && /www/server/python/bin/python3 main.py,按需设周期 - 验证与调试:查看Supervisor日志(/www/wwwlogs/supervisor/openclaw.log);若报错,优先检查config.yaml格式缩进、API密钥是否为空、目标URL是否可访问
费用/成本通常受哪些因素影响
- 服务器配置(CPU/内存):OpenClaw多线程运行时对内存敏感,低配机器易OOM
- 采集频率与目标站点反爬强度:高频请求需配合代理IP池,代理成本另计
- 是否启用截图/OCR等重负载模块:依赖chromium或tesseract,需额外安装并占用磁盘空间
- 宝塔专业版授权状态:免费版不支持Supervisor管理器,需手动写systemd服务或升级
为了拿到准确部署成本,你通常需要准备:服务器OS版本、宝塔版本、OpenClaw具体分支(GitHub release tag)、是否已购代理服务、是否需对接企业微信/钉钉告警。
常见坑与避坑清单
- 坑1:在宝塔终端用root执行pip install,但Supervisor以www用户运行 → 解决:统一在Python项目管理器中安装依赖,或修改Supervisor启动用户为root(不推荐)
- 坑2:config.yaml中缩进用Tab而非空格 → 解决:用宝塔文件编辑器开启“显示空白字符”,确保全为2/4空格缩进
- 坑3:视频教程用宝塔7.x界面,而你用8.x → 解决:8.x中【计划任务】→【Shell脚本】位置不变,但【Python项目】入口移至【软件商店】→【已安装】→【Python项目管理器】
- 坑4:未关闭宝塔防火墙的“禁ping+端口放行”策略 → 解决:若OpenClaw需监听本地端口(如Webhook),须在【安全】→【放行端口】中添加对应端口
FAQ
OpenClaw(龙虾)在宝塔怎么恢复视频教程靠谱吗?是否合规?
OpenClaw本身为MIT协议开源项目,代码公开可审计;在宝塔恢复属于标准Linux运维操作,不涉及违规。但需注意:采集行为必须遵守目标网站robots.txt及当地《反不正当竞争法》《计算机信息网络国际联网安全保护管理办法》,尤其对Amazon、Shopee等平台,高频请求可能触发风控。合规前提是:控制QPS、设置User-Agent、避开登录态数据、不绕过验证码。
OpenClaw(龙虾)在宝塔怎么恢复视频教程适合哪些卖家?
适用于具备基础Linux命令能力的中国跨境卖家,特别是:独立站运营者(需监控竞品上新)、多平台比价团队(SHEIN/Temu类目选品)、ERP自研团队(需对接OpenClaw API)。不建议纯新手直接操作;若无服务器运维经验,应先完成宝塔【Python项目管理器】和【Supervisor】两个模块的官方入门文档学习。
OpenClaw(龙虾)在宝塔怎么恢复视频教程常见失败原因是什么?如何排查?
最常见失败原因前三名:① config.yaml语法错误(YAML缩进/冒号后缺空格)→ 查看Supervisor stderr日志;② Python依赖未装全(如缺失playwright)→ 进入项目目录执行pip list | grep playwright;③ 宝塔PHP/Node.js环境干扰Python进程→ 确认未在同端口起其他服务,且Supervisor配置中未混用不同Python解释器路径。
结尾
OpenClaw(龙虾)在宝塔怎么恢复视频教程,本质是标准化运维复现,关键在环境一致性与日志溯源。

